末态中的自旋 - 轨道相互作用作为三体裂变中 T odd 关联的可能原因

核理论 2010-10-27 v1

摘要

本文讨论了一种三体裂变模型,其中第三个粒子(α粒子)是由于颈缩断裂处核势的非绝热变化而发射的。提出了α粒子能量和角分布的表达式。研究表明,裂变系统的自旋与α粒子轨道动量之间的相互作用(即末态中的自旋 - 轨道相互作用)导致了近期观测到的α粒子发射不对称性,这在形式上可与 T odd 关联联系起来。该模型预测不对称性对α粒子发射方向相对于裂变轴的角度无强烈依赖,这与实验数据相符。
